chargesheet

CHARJ-sheet

Definition

A formal document prepared by law enforcement agencies detailing the specific accusations brought against a person or entity in a court of law.

Etymology

This term is a compound word formed from 'charge' (to accuse) and 'sheet' (a paper document), which emerged in British and Indian legal contexts to denote the primary record of an investigation.
